Well don't forget the 5 rushing TDs as well, and the fact taht under Young the Titans won 5 games in a row (when many didn't even pick them to win 5 all year)

But I think that a lot of the Vince Young "haters" here think that the rest of us have anointed him the heir apparent to great QBs. I can tell you, from my perspective, that's not the case. We're just saying he had a pretty solid rookie year, helped the Titans significantly overachieve, looks to be an exciting and marketable player for years to come and should only get better. Was he the best choice to be on the cover? Probably not, but it's not a bad choice

The hate for VY is because he's getting so much press and he wasn't even that great during his rookie season. True, he did make some plays that won games, i.e. his touchdown run against the Texans in overtime last year, but his stats as a quarterback don't reflect that. Plus the defense was more of a factor in the games they won.

It's like the hate for Michael Vick when he made the Pro Bowl after throwing 12 touchdowns and 13 interceptions two seasons ago. I did hear that they wanted to put L.T. on the cover, but L.T. said no lol.
